Enable theft detection lock:

Start by opening Settings on your phone.

Scroll down and tap on Google.

After going to Google Settings, select All Services.

Scroll down and look for the theft protection option and tap on it.

Turn on the theft detection lock toggle. This feature will automatically lock your phone if it is snatched or stolen, adding an additional layer of security.

Set password to power off:

Go back to your phone's Settings and go to Security and Safety.

Tap on More security and privacy.

Enable the toggle for Require password to power off. This will ensure that even if someone tries to turn off your phone, they won’t be able to do so without entering the correct password – something that only you know.
